Morgan, Lewis & Bockius LLP, one of the world’s leading global law firms with offices in strategic hubs of commerce, law, and government across North America, Asia, Europe, and the Middle East, is seeking to hire an Information Technology Product Manager oversee the development and delivery of IT products that meet market needs and align with the company’s strategic goals. This role involves managing the product lifecycle from conception to launch, working closely with cross-functional teams, and ensuring that products are delivered on time, within scope, and within budget.

Reporting to the Manager of IT Products, the IT Product Manager will manage user experience and functionality by designing new products and enhancing existing products through technically rigorous, strategically sound business analysis. They will also ensure the success of new products and functionality through the development of supporting business processes, demonstration examples and training scenarios.

Key responsibilities include:

Product Strategy and Vision:

  • In collaboration with Manager, IT Products, develop and communicate firm appropriate product vision and strategies.

  • Analyze new product opportunities with the business units and procurement.

  • Define product roadmaps that align with company goals and customer needs.

Product Development:

  • Gather and prioritize product and customer requirements.

  • Work closely with development and technical teams to deliver product features.

  • Manage the product backlog and coordinate sprints and releases.

  • Maintain and prioritize the product backlog to ensure alignment with strategic goals.

  • Coordinate with development teams to ensure backlog items are clearly defined and actionable.

  • Oversee software release management to ensure timely and high-quality product launches.

  • Ensure continuous integration and continuous delivery (CI/CD) practices are followed through Devops and Jira in line with firm development standards

Stakeholder Management:

  •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to ensure alignment on product goals.

  • Provide regular updates to senior management and other stakeholders

  • Act as the primary point of contact for product-related inquiries.

  • Communicate effectively with end-users to gather feedback and ensure their needs are met.

Product Lifecycle Management:

  • Monitor product performance and gather user feedback for continuous improvement.

  • Define and track key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ure product success.

  • Facilitate user acceptance testing (UAT) to validate product functionality and performance.
